Abstract

Systems and methods to incentivize engagement in security awareness training are disclosed. The systems and methods include a user enrolling in a simulated self-phishing system that enables the user to receive simulated self-phishing communications and be scored on the user's interactions with the simulated self-phishing communications. The method includes identifying organizational information of the user, and communicating simulated self-phishing communications based at least on the organizational information of the user. The method includes receiving interaction data of the user with the simulated self-phishing communications. The method may generate a score of the user based at least on the interaction data.

Claims (35)

1 . A method comprising:

receiving, by a server, a request of a user of an organization to enroll in a simulated self-phishing system that enables the user to receive simulated self-phishing communications and be scored on the user's interactions with the simulated self-phishing communications;

identifying, by the server responsive to the request, organizational information of the user;

communicating, by the server, to one or more devices of the user one or more simulated self-phishing communications generated responsive to the user's enrollment in the simulated self-phishing system and based at least on the organizational information of the user;

receiving, by the server, interaction data of the user with the one or more simulated self-phishing communications; and

generating, by the server for display, a score of the user based at least on the interaction data.

2 . The method of claim 1 , further comprising receiving, by the server responsive to the request to enroll, a selection of the user to be in one of a single user mode or a multi-user mode of the simulated self-phishing system.

3 . The method of claim 2 , wherein the multi-user mode of the simulated self-phishing system is configured to display the score of the user with scores of other users in an enumerated list of scores.

4 . The method of claim 2 , further comprising receiving, by the server responsive to the selection of the user to be in the single user mode of the simulated self-phishing system, one or more parameters to adjust one of content or delivery of the one or more simulated self-phishing communications.

5 . The method of claim 4 , wherein the one or more parameters comprises identification of one or more of the following: a range of time in which to receive the one or more simulated self-phishing communications, a number of how many simulated self-phishing communications to receive, and a time window in which a first simulated self-phishing communication is to be sent.

6 . The method of claim 4 , wherein the one or more parameters comprise identification of one or more of the following: a type of simulated self-phishing communication, a difficulty level of the simulated self-phishing communication and a mode of communication of the simulated self-phishing communication.

7 . The method of claim 2 , further comprising generating, by the server, the one or more simulated self-phishing communications based at least on the selection of the user to be in one of the single user mode or the multi-user mode of the simulated self-phishing system.

8 . The method of claim 1 , further comprising receiving, by the server, personal information of the user comprising one or more of the following: a personal email address, a personal phone number, information of one or more social media accounts, a hometown of the user, a birthdate, a gender, a club, an interest or an affiliation.

9 . The method of claim 7 , further comprising generating, by the server, the one or more simulated self-phishing communications using the personal information of the user.

10 . The method of claim 7 , further comprising adjusting, by the server responsive to receiving the personal information, the score of the user.

11 . The method of claim 1 , further comprising generating, by the server responsive to the interaction data, a test to communicate to the user.

12 . The method of claim 10 , further comprising adjusting, by the server, responsive to receiving results of the test, the score of the user.
